單片機應用系統(tǒng)設計實例PPT學習教案_第1頁
單片機應用系統(tǒng)設計實例PPT學習教案_第2頁
單片機應用系統(tǒng)設計實例PPT學習教案_第3頁
單片機應用系統(tǒng)設計實例PPT學習教案_第4頁
單片機應用系統(tǒng)設計實例PPT學習教案_第5頁
已閱讀5頁,還剩39頁未讀 繼續(xù)免費閱讀

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領

文檔簡介

1、會計學1單片機應用系統(tǒng)設計實例單片機應用系統(tǒng)設計實例第1頁/共44頁第2頁/共44頁第3頁/共44頁第4頁/共44頁nvoid main(void)nnwhile(1)nn P1_0=0;n delay(5000);n P1_0=1;n delay(5000);nnnvoid delay(uint t) /延時延時0.1*t毫秒毫秒n n uint i; n do n n for(i=0;i10;i+) n ; n while(t-); n void delay(uint t); /聲明函數(shù)聲明函數(shù)第5頁/共44頁第6頁/共44頁第7頁/共44頁第8頁/共44頁第9頁/共44頁第10頁/共44

2、頁#include uchar _crol_(uchar a,uchar n); /*函數(shù)原型函數(shù)原型*/uchar _cror_(uchar a,uchar n); /*函數(shù)原型,右循環(huán)函數(shù)原型,右循環(huán)*/ void main(void)uint a = 0 xfe; while(1)P1=a;delay(5000); a=_crol_(a,1); 第11頁/共44頁第12頁/共44頁第13頁/共44頁第14頁/共44頁 你正在專心看你正在專心看書,突然電話鈴響,書,突然電話鈴響,于是你記下正在看的于是你記下正在看的書的頁數(shù),去接電話書的頁數(shù),去接電話,接完電話后再回來,接完電話后再回來接著

3、看書。接著看書。第15頁/共44頁中斷中斷是指由于某種隨機事件(甲方是指由于某種隨機事件(甲方)的發(fā)生,計算機(乙方)暫?,F(xiàn))的發(fā)生,計算機(乙方)暫停現(xiàn)行程序的運行,轉去執(zhí)行另一程序行程序的運行,轉去執(zhí)行另一程序,以處理發(fā)生的事件,處理完畢后,以處理發(fā)生的事件,處理完畢后又自動返回原來的程序繼續(xù)運行。又自動返回原來的程序繼續(xù)運行。將能引起中斷的事件稱為將能引起中斷的事件稱為中斷源中斷源。CPUCPU現(xiàn)行運行的程序稱為現(xiàn)行運行的程序稱為主主程序程序。處理隨機事件的程序稱為處理隨機事件的程序稱為中斷服務中斷服務子程序子程序。 第16頁/共44頁TCOTCON NTF1 TR1 TF0 TR0 T

4、F1 TR1 TF0 TR0 IE1 IT1 IE0 IT0IE0/IE1IE0/IE1:外部中斷申請標志位:外部中斷申請標志位: =0=0:沒有外部中斷申請;:沒有外部中斷申請; =1=1:有外部中斷申請。:有外部中斷申請。IT0/IT1IT0/IT1:外部中斷請求的觸發(fā)方式選擇位:外部中斷請求的觸發(fā)方式選擇位: =0=0:在:在INT0/INT1INT0/INT1端申請中斷的信號低電平有效端申請中斷的信號低電平有效; ; =1 =1:在:在INT0/INT1INT0/INT1端申請中斷的信號負跳變有效端申請中斷的信號負跳變有效. .第17頁/共44頁 EA ET2 ES ET1 EX1 E

5、T0 EX0IEIEEX0/EX1EX0/EX1位:位: 分別是分別是INT0/INT1INT0/INT1的中斷允許控制位的中斷允許控制位: : =0 =0 時禁止中斷;時禁止中斷; =1 =1 時允許中斷。時允許中斷。EAEA:總的中斷允許控制位(總開關):總的中斷允許控制位(總開關): =0 =0 時禁止全部中斷;時禁止全部中斷;=1 =1 時允許中斷。時允許中斷。第18頁/共44頁第19頁/共44頁第20頁/共44頁第21頁/共44頁第22頁/共44頁第23頁/共44頁第24頁/共44頁第25頁/共44頁GATEC/TM1M0GATEC/TM1M0TMOD00000001第26頁/共44

6、頁61Tp=12112 10s350 10500001n定時50ms,需要計數(shù):定時器初始值:定時器初始值:6553650000155360 30 x CB定時定時500ms,需要中斷,需要中斷10次。次。第27頁/共44頁第28頁/共44頁第29頁/共44頁第30頁/共44頁LEDLED數(shù)碼管的數(shù)碼管的結構結構:(1 1)共陽)共陽(2 2)共陰)共陰第31頁/共44頁公共陽極公共陽極h g f e d c b ah g f e d c b aa ab bc cd dg ge ef fh h公共陰極公共陰極h g f e d c b ah g f e d c b aa ab bc cd dg

7、 ge ef fh hh g f ah g f a高電平點亮高電平點亮低電平點亮低電平點亮接高電平接高電平接地接地第32頁/共44頁第33頁/共44頁共陽共陽LEDLED數(shù)碼管:數(shù)碼管:公共端公共端( (字位字位) ) 接高電平,接高電平,筆劃筆劃( (字段字段) ) 置為低電平置為低電平就被點亮了就被點亮了比如要顯示比如要顯示“0”0” 須令須令a b c d e fa b c d e f 為為“0 0” 電平,電平,g hg h為為“1 1”電平。電平。共陽極共陽極h g f e d c b ah g f e d c b aa ab bc cd dg ge ef fh hh g f e d c b ah g f e d c b a累加器累加器 A1 1 0 0 0 0 0 01 1 0 0 0 0 0 00C0H = “0”0C0H = “0”第34頁/共44頁第35頁/共

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經權益所有人同意不得將文件中的內容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
  • 6. 下載文件中如有侵權或不適當內容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論